A quaint and quirky little town in the Karoo, famed for its...

A quaint and quirky little town in the Karoo, famed for its terrible flash flood in 1981, which killed 104 residents, and all but wiped out the town. We tried to visit the Flood Museum but it turned out to be closed on Friday afternoons, which was exactly when we went to visit it. The Grand Hotel was wonderful! We had the best pizzas ever there on Friday evening (pizza night!) and it was such a friendly place. We were in Laingsburg for the Laingsburg Karoo Maratohn, a delightful low key running event thought the truly spectacular stunningly beautuful scenery of the Karoo. We loved it!

It was lovely to be part of an awesome and rich history and...

It was lovely to be part of an awesome and rich history and to explore the museum, transport museum and the whole little town - so very interesting and one can walk through the whole town within an hour! The Hotel and pub were outstanding with their meals. It was great to go on the world's shortest tour on the red bus. It is full of such an interesting history and everything makes one feel that one is back in the 1800's but at the same time it is a peaceful town where one could truly "rest"! Unfortunately we didn't see/hear any ghosts and we were not able to see inside the Courthouse, Pink Chapel, Logan's Tweedside Lodge and Schreiber's cottage! We also couldn't find the cemetry.

Merweville is a beautiful town! Friendly community.

Merweville is a beautiful town! Friendly community. The town is very clean and neat. The best coffee and breakfast at Die Boekklub with a shop to buy presents for family at home. There is a nougat factory as well - Karoo Blessings, unfortunately they were closed when we passed through, but we could find their yummy treats at "Die Boekklub" in town. The Graveyard is well looked after, we visited a family grave and we were very impressed! Everywhere you drive, people will greet you with a friendly smile! It gives you a warm feeling of caring! Loved the town.
